Output d1b672c4c85017a6793cac72ed050c041615f23cb6d60175547b27404e49b595:16

value
91106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 527ea2a9d8f2f251400734e34dbf0f76ba00b4a7 OP_EQUAL
address
39DD34CaZLq3sqwkbi4G1nc6LeyVCAgAd5
transaction
d1b672c4c85017a6793cac72ed050c041615f23cb6d60175547b27404e49b595
confirmations
312735
spent
true